GTA Közösség - A magyar GTA fórum

San Andreas Multiplayer (SA-MP) => SA-MP: Szerverfejlesztés => Segítségkérés => A témát indította: kriszrap - 2013. február 26. - 21:45:13

Cím: nem értem miért nem jó a tömb hossz:(
Írta: kriszrap - 2013. február 26. - 21:45:13
Sziasztok:)
 

enum hInfo
{
  haznev[128]
};
new HazInfo[MAX_HAZ][hInfo];
HazInfo[lvsflshazid[playerid]][haznev]=inputtext;

 
hiba kód:
 

error 047: array sizes do not match, or destination array is too small

 
mi a megoldás?:)
elõre is köszi:)
Cím: nem értem miért nem jó a tömb hossz:(
Írta: Raidon - 2013. február 26. - 21:49:31
hát ha nem raktad be, akkor biztos... amúgy mysql pluginból több van, neked ez kell (include neve alapján):

http://forum.sa-mp.com/showthread.php?t=7106
Cím: nem értem miért nem jó a tömb hossz:(
Írta: TengeriMalac - 2013. február 26. - 21:52:41
Idézetet írta: Raidon date=1361911771\" data-ipsquote-contentapp=\"forums\" data-ipsquote-contenttype=\"forums\" data-ipsquote-contentid=\"34226\" data-ipsquote-contentclass=\"forums_Topic
hát ha nem raktad be, akkor biztos... amúgy mysql pluginból több van, neked ez kell (include neve alapján):

http://forum.sa-mp.com/showthread.php?t=7106
 
ennek mi köze van hozzá?


Ha így akarsz neki értéket adni, akkor egy brutálisan nagy érték kell neki, különben hibát fog rá kiírni..
Az inputtext alapértelmezett maximális nagyságát akarja hozzáformázni, ami több, mint az általad megadott 128.
Ha normálisan formázod, akkor nem fog hibát kiírni.
 
format(HazInfo[lvsflshazid[playerid]][haznev], 128, \"%s\", inputtext);
Cím: nem értem miért nem jó a tömb hossz:(
Írta: kriszrap - 2013. február 27. - 20:40:31
köszönöm ment a + :)